Notes
Abraham met thirty one Igerera B members and the chairman Mr Charles told the meeting that they have been working on the goats shelter, he said that one member gave a group five iron sheets for the goats shelter.They are left with two iron sheets to complete the goats shelter. The chairman said that the government is planning to divide the sub county into two and they hope to be in another sub county in this financial year. The speaker of Namutumba rural sub county thanked Kibo for making communities organized which the government has failed to do, he told the community to work hard if they want to benefit from government programs. They are going to start a saving scheme during the harvest time which will be in June this year.
